Tax ID Number: How to Get It and Where You Need It

What is a tax number and why you need it 🧾

A tax number is an official identifier used by Georgia's tax authorities. Besides tax filings, it is commonly required for property transactions, opening bank accounts, employment, and business activities.

Typical situations when a tax number is required

  • Buying or selling property.
  • Opening a bank account or conducting international transfers.
  • Starting work under an employment contract.
  • Registering a company or signing long-term leases.

Even non-residents often need a tax number to complete legal and financial procedures.

Who should get one: residents and non-residents 🤝

If you plan to buy property, work, run a business, or stay long-term in Georgia, obtaining a tax number is a practical step. For short visits it may not be necessary, but for any formal transaction it is often requested.

How to obtain a tax number: step-by-step guide 🛠️

  1. Prepare documents:
    • Passport or other ID.
    • Copies of visa pages or residence documents if you are a foreigner.
    • Proof of address if needed.
  2. Apply at a local tax office or authorized service center.
  3. Complete the application and submit copies of your documents.
  4. Receive the tax number in paper or electronic form. The administrative process is usually straightforward.

Tip: Real estate agents, notaries or lawyers often assist with obtaining the number during a transaction.

Documents commonly requested for property deals 🏠

  • ID documents of buyer and seller.
  • Tax numbers of involved parties.
  • Sales agreement, payment proofs and registry extracts.

Ask your agent for a checklist before signing contracts to avoid delays.

Common mistakes and how to avoid them ⚠️

  • Arriving without required copies of your documents.
  • Missing consistency between your name in ID and the tax record.
  • Underestimating the need for the tax number when dealing with banks.

Practical advice: keep both digital and printed copies of your tax number for quick reference during transactions.

Tips for foreigners 🌍

  • If you cannot appear in person, appoint a trusted representative with a notarized power of attorney.
  • Use a translator or ask your agent for language support when dealing with officials.
  • Confirm at what stage of the property transaction the tax number will be required to avoid last-minute issues.

Real-life examples (practical) 📌

  • An investor buying an apartment for rentals needs a tax number to register rental income and open a local bank account.
  • A foreign employee needs a tax number for payroll and social contributions.
  • Banks may request a tax number for transfers and account verification during property purchases.

Working with officials and service providers ✅

  • Ask for written confirmation of the information you receive.
  • Check office hours and whether online services are available.
  • Consider expedited options through official channels if timing is important.
